Project Details

RTI International is seeking full-time field supervisors to provide field support and management oversight on a school-based computerized health surveillance study. The in-school survey administrator teams are responsible for administering school-based surveys to students.

The Field Supervisor position oversees survey administrators on the National Youth Risk Behavior Study (YRBS) NYRBS is a biennial, school-based survey that monitors health-risk behaviors among U.S. high school students to inform public health policies and interventions. NYRBS is a critical resource for understanding adolescent health behaviors, guiding interventions, and shaping policies to improve youth well-being across the United States.

RTI International is a non-profit research organization contracted to collect data. We are working with approximately 300 schools across the country including public, private, Catholic, and virtual schools.

This is a temporary full-time position that will offer an average of 40 hours per week once hired through the duration of the data collection period of June 2027
